在线源的配置
配置环境:
[root@localhost ~]# cat /etc/redhat-release
CentOS release 6.5 (Final)
[root@localhost ~]# uname -r
2.6.32-431.el6.x86_64
1.查找国内权威的源
在centos官网:https://www.centos.org/
2.以阿里源为例(点击阿里源的链接):
选择与自己服务器一样的操作系统,此处以centos6.5 内核是2.6.32-431.el6.x86_64
手动配置yum源
2.1 该源是没有gpg密钥验证
[root@localhost ~]# cd /etc/yum.repos.d/
[root@localhost yum.repos.d]# cat ali.repo
[ali]
name=ali
baseurl=http://mirrors.aliyun.com/centos/6/os/x86_64/
enabled=1
gpgcheck=0
[root@localhost yum.repos.d]# yum clean all
Loaded plugins: fastestmirror, security
Cleaning repos: ali
Cleaning up Everything
Cleaning up list of fastest mirrors
[root@localhost yum.repos.d]# yum repolist
Loaded plugins: fastestmirror, security
Determining fastest mirrors
ali | 3.7 kB 00:00
ali/primary_db | 4.7 MB 00:04
repo id repo name status
ali ali 6,696
repolist: 6,696
**注意:**baseurl中目录的选择
- centos :在阿里源的操作系统选择和本地的操作系统必须是一样的,
- 6:要选择6而不选择6.5的目录,在6.5的目录下有一个文件时readme其中有介绍
- os:代表的是操作系统
- x86_64:代表的内核的版本
2.2 这是使用gpg密钥的配置
[root@localhost yum.repos.d]# mkdir /etc/pki/rpm-gpg/ali
[root@localhost yum.repos.d]# cd /etc/pki/rpm-gpg/ali/
[root@localhost ali]# wget http://mirrors.aliyun.com/centos/6/os/x86_64/RPM-GPG-KEY-CentOS-6
[root@localhost ali]# cat /etc/yum.repos.d/ali.repo
[ali]
name=ali
baseurl=http://mirrors.aliyun.com/centos/6/os/x86_64/
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/ali/RPM-GPG-KEY-CentOS-6
使用官方提供的repo文件
此处有具体的下载yum源的方法: